Output 68bf34b0b2bd0521e637892461f24f97e519964ad21bdd62ecce534995cbef3c:20

value
17921659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a0b5d0e5a1c008843b62f55461619f8a87eeb91 OP_EQUAL
address
3EGvnZnvCbkKoy2XgDn5eJKyNGNQ8Hyfpe
transaction
68bf34b0b2bd0521e637892461f24f97e519964ad21bdd62ecce534995cbef3c
spent
true